What is the current political situation in Georgia regarding elections?
Georgia's political landscape is tense with opposition and some international observers not recognizing recent parliamentary election results as free and fair. Protests have erupted in Tbilisi and other cities against alleged election falsifications, with the government facing criticism for its handling of demonstrations.

What is the humanitarian stance of Georgia towards Ukrainians?
Georgia has shown considerable humanitarian support towards Ukrainian citizens by extending their right to stay in Georgia without a visa for an additional year. This gesture reflects Georgia's solidarity with Ukraine and its people amidst ongoing conflicts with Russia, emphasizing their shared geopolitical concerns.
What role does the European Court of Human Rights play in Georgia's situation?
The European Court of Human Rights has ordered Russia to compensate Georgia for human rights violations following the 2008 war. This decision highlights the legal and moral support Georgia receives from European institutions in its efforts to address past grievances and seek justice for affected citizens.
